Please do not execute reprogramming "0" for the bit which
has already been programed "0". Overwrite operation may
generate unerasable bit. In case of reprogramming "0" to
the data which has been programed "1".
For example, changing data from "10111101" to
"10111100" requires "11111110" programming.

Parameter Blocks: The boot block architecture includes
parameter blocks to facilitate storage of frequently update
small parameters that would normally require an
EEPROM. By using software techniques, the word-rewrite
functionality of EEPROMs can be emulated. Each boot
block component contains six parameter blocks of 4K
words (4,096 words) each. The protection of the parameter
block is controlled using a combination of the V
and block lock-bit.
